DIY: Change Color of M Performance Steering Wheel Stripe
So I've been having the MP steering wheel v1 for half a year. Recently as I was cleaning the steering wheel with alcantara cleaner and microfiber towels I noticed that the color of the stripe has been fading. I don't usually grab the top of the wheel while driving so I was kinda upset about the quality.
Then as I purchased red M1/M2 buttons from IND (only M2 button was installed since I like it that way), I started thinking about refinishing/wrapping the stripe. At first I considered red leather dye, however I am not sure if it's going to look good on top of partially faded blue stripe. Therefore I went with vinyl and it's reversible. As someone suggest, I got 1/4 inch wide vinyl from amazon thinking it's the perfect width, but that was not the case as the the vinyl was much wider than the stripe. So I applied the vinyl and used a blow dryer to make it stick and stretch along the edge of the stripe. And the hardest part was trimming the excess vinyl. I was worried about damaging the steering wheel, therefore I cut the excess with a plastic razor. The plastic razor was no where as sharp as a metal one but I took a lot of patience and cut it slowly. Eventually I cut all the excess and tuck the edge of the vinyl into the gap between the stripe and alcantara. My work was not nearly as perfect as I hope but I am still pretty happy with the result. For people who want to change their stripe color, my advice would be: 1. Get a wider vinyl since you are trimming it anyway. 2. A hobby knife might work better than my plastic razor but you need to be really careful not to cut the stitchings at the bottom. 3. Do it slowly and be patient. This is only a 30 min job so don't hurry or you might damage your wheel or the vinyl and startover. I really hope I can inspire anyone who is not happy with faded stripes or just want to change the color to match the interior. Cheers.

Looks good! We did this on our e92M3 (orange stripe) back in the day.
Going slightly wider than the wheel strip helps as the vinyl will get a bit thinner as you stretch when wrapping and try to position the seam underneath.
